Telugu people (Telugu: తెలుగువారు, romanized: Teluguvāru), also called Telugus, are an ethnolinguistic group who speak the Telugu language and are native to the Indian states of Andhra Pradesh, Telangana and Yanam district of Puducherry. They are the most populous of the four major Dravidian groups.
